Vegan means no animal-derived ingredients: no beeswax, honey, lanolin, carmine, collagen, silk or milk. Some ingredients like glycerin can come from plants or animals, so a vegan claim on the label matters.

Full ingredient list

Sorbitol, Mentha Piperita Leaf Water, Hydrated Silica [nano, Aqua, Aloe Barbadensis Leaf Juice, Lauryl Glucoside, Xanthan Gum, Aroma, Charcoal Powder Bentonite Sodium Fluoride, Sodium Benzoate, Stevia Rebaudiana Extract, Citric Acid, Potassium Sorbate, Contient Fluorure De Sodium (1450 Ppm De Fluor).
